## Authentication

Matchbox (the pairing service) exposes GC pause metrics at `/internal/gc`. Pauses over 400ms page on-call. The endpoint is behind the Kestrelgate proxy; anonymous calls return 403. Auth is a static service key in the `X-Matchbox-Key` header — no OAuth, no refresh. Keys rotate quarterly; stale keys fail closed, which looks identical to a network partition, so check auth first. The current on-call key for the GC metrics endpoint is below.

API key for kahap-faduf: vxb23-Ir087IkWYmBJt7KRtkyhUA3

Step 4: Migrating validator plugins. Before enabling the new plugin loader in Veldcheck 3.x, confirm every custom validator implements the revised `validate(batch)` signature; legacy single-record hooks will silently no-op. Run the compatibility scanner against the plugin registry and resolve any flagged modules before proceeding. Once the scan passes, point the registry migrator at the metadata store using the connection string below.

primary connection of yagep-kahip = redis://giliel_svc:zYiKsLL2PLpfPL@db-348f.xolmarsys.corp:5432/fenwyn

Subject: Taxegrine cache cut-over — summary

Hi Rowan,

The cut-over of the Taxegrine tax-rate lookup cache completed last night without incident. We drained the old Millbrane nodes first, warmed the new cache from a fresh snapshot, and verified lookup parity across both jurisdictions' test suites before flipping traffic. Latency is down roughly a third, and no stale-rate reads were observed during the soak period. For the release record, the configuration now active in production is as follows.

settings of tagef-bawif:
DRUIX_HOST=druix.zemvarlabs.internal
DRUIX_PORT=8000